Foundation damage repair involves identifying and addressing issues that compromise the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include assessments to determine the extent of damage, followed by specialized techniques such as under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ization to restore support. The goal is to correct problems caused by shifting soil, water intrusion, or settling, helping to prevent further structural deterioration and ensuring the safety of the property.
This service helps solve common problems like uneven or cracked flooring, sticking doors and windows, visible cracks in walls, and uneven or sloping floors. Over time, these issues can worsen if left unaddressed, leading to significant structural concerns or costly repairs. Foundation repair services aim to stabilize the foundation, eliminate ongoing movement, and restore the property’s structural soundness, providing peace of mind for property owners.
Properties that typically require foundation damage repair include residential homes, especially those built on expansive or shifting soil, as well as commercial buildings and multi-unit complexes. Older structures are often more susceptible to foundation issues due to aging materials and changing ground conditions. Foundation Damage Repair Costs - The average cost for foundation repair services typically 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of damage. Minor repairs may be closer to $2,000, while extensive foundation work can exceed $10,000.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ific conditions.
Repair Material and Method Expenses - Costs vary based on the repair method used, such as piering or slabjacking, which can range from $1,000 to $5,000. The choice of materials and complexity of the repair influence the final cost. Budgeting for these services should consider potential additional expenses.
Extent of Damage and Structural Impact - The severity of foundation damage impacts the overall cost, with minor cracks costing around $1,000 and severe settling or shifting exceeding $10,000. A professional assessment is recommended to determine the appropriate repair approach and cost estimate.
Location and Accessibility Factors - Costs may increase if the foundation is difficult to access or if the property is in a remote area, with prices potentially rising by 10-20%. Local contractors can provide tailored estimates considering site-specific conditions and requ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ation damage? Signs can include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around frames or molding.
How can foundation damage affect a property? It may lead to structural instability, increased repair costs over time, and potential safety hazards if not addressed promptly.
What repair options are available for foundation damage? Local pros may offer solutions such as slab jacking, piering, or underpinning to stabilize and restore the foundation.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ed based on crack size, location, and progression.
